Generally speaking, if you have a modern pc with windows XP and a fast CPU, you should use the collectors edition which is availible for download from The Home Of The Underdogs. This is CPU limited so whatever speed your pc the game is playable, just turn down the movement/fire speeds in the options in-game. If you are getting messed up graphics with the collectors edition, there is a special .exe that is for windows 2000/xp only which should fix this. Don't try to run the collectors edition in DOS or with DOSbox. To get a smooth game in dos or windows 95 with the original, you need a pentium 75mhz or less. Not sure about DOSbox, but I would say keep increasing CPU cycles till you get a smooth game. Im guessing you would need a very fast PC to get UFO to run smooth in DOSbox as it's a DOS4GW game (probably about 3GHz+). |

![]() You can change the game´s music, it is pretty easy. Just rename the desired midi as any of the ones at sound folder. Copy it. Done.
Example, I hate the music of tactic combat so erased Gmtactic, copied Gmlose that i like most, renamed the copy file as Gmtactic and i can hear Gmlose when i am in tactical combat.
